Can I live in Barcelona on $1,500/month?
Living in Barcelona on $1,500/mo is rated "Tight Budget". Budget allocates ~$864 to rent, $224 to groceries, $148 to dining.
Can I live in Cape Town on $1,500/month?
In Cape Town, $1,500/mo is rated "Moderate". Allocations: $708 rent, $274 groceries, $241 dining.
Is Barcelona or Cape Town cheaper?
Cape Town is generally cheaper. COL+Rent: Barcelona 44.3 vs Cape Town 28.5 (NYC=100).
What is $1,500/mo in Barcelona worth in Cape Town?
$1,500/mo of purchasing power in Barcelona equals ~$965/mo in Cape Town using COL adjustment.
